基于C语言实现kmp算法(源码)
buildPartialMatchTable函数用于构建部分匹配表,该表存储了模式字符串中每个位置的最长相同前缀后缀的长度。 kmpSearch函数使用KMP算法进行字符串匹配,利用构建的部分匹配表,在匹配过程中实现跳跃匹配。主函数中定义了一个文本字符串和一个模式字符串,并调用kmpSearch函数进行匹配。如果找到了匹配的位置,则输出匹配的位置;否则输出未找到匹配。
1.11KB
文件大小:
评论区